A woman was convicted at Craigavon Crown Court on Tuesday for claiming benefits she was not entitled to.

Alicia Sloane (51) of Colban Crescent, Lurgan claimed Employment and Support Allowance and Housing Benefit totalling £26,414 while failing to declare capital.

She was given a nine month prison sentence suspended for three years.

Mrs Sloane has repaid all money wrongfully obtained to the Department for Communities.
